What's new in Inkist 1.4
Dec 11, 2013
- Updated Interface and Icon
- Adds option to move tools to the right side of the window
- Improved performance for zooming and brushing
- Fixes bug where selection/text tools wouldn't work after changing canvas size
- Detached palettes now hide when Inkist is in the background
- Adds support for Wacom multitouch gestures (more gestures will come in the future)
New in Inkist 1.3 (May 17, 2013)
- Adds Dodge/Burn blending brush tools
- Now opens and saves .psd files (layer names, opacities, and blend modes not supported)
- Changes default brushes in accordance with iPad version
- Improves support for sharing files with Inkist on iPad
- Added menu option to load the default brushes on top of currently existing brushes
- Fixes bugs with deleting and hiding layers
- HSL Tool now previews in real time
